What is a Hive Linked Camera?
A Hive Linked Camera has a built-in cloud connection that lets you link it directly to the PTZOptics HIVE platform, no bridges, converters, or extra hardware. Once linked, the camera can be controlled, monitored, and managed remotely from anywhere.
How to Link Your Camera to Hive Studio
1. Open your web browser and enter the camera's IP address to access the Web UI.
2. Log in to the camera's Web UI using your credentials.
3. In the left-hand navigation bar, click on the Hive Studio option.
4. A prompt will appear asking you to link the camera to Hive Studio. Click on the Link Device button.

5. You will be prompted to confirm the linking process for the selected camera. Click Continue to proceed.

6. You will be redirected to the Hive Studio login page. Enter your Hive Studio credentials and click Continue.

7. Next select your studio and click Continue.

8. Lastly, enter your camera's login credentials to complete the linking process and click Confirm & Link Camera.

9. A new tab will open in your browser, taking you to Hive Studio, where you can see your linked camera.
Adding a Camera
To add a camera, go to the device tray on the left-hand side of the screen and click the plus sign icon. You will then be brought to the “Add a video source” window.
All available IP-based & USB camera devices will appear in the source list on the left-hand side of the window. Select the camera you wish to add and click “Continue.” This will take you to the “Configuration” window.
Here, you can adjust the protocol, camera name, IP address, and control port. Once you are happy with your settings, click “Continue.”
The final step requires you to select your camera brand and model, allowing the PTZOptics Hive Studio to calibrate your camera. If you are using a camera brand other than PTZOptics, a list of compatible brands can be seen in the drop-down tab.
Once you are done, click “Continue.”
You will be prompted with one final look at the control & advanced settings, which are adjustable from the window below. Once satisfied with your settings, click “Save and Finish.” Your camera has now been added to the PTZOptics Hive Studio.

During the camera setup process select your camera’s make and model from the list. If it appears, a driver has been built specifically for your camera.
Use Generic Drivers if Necessary: If your camera model is not listed, you can still select “Other” in the brand or model section and then choose between HTTP, VISCA OVER IP or ONVIF.
Camera Calibration
Most PTZOptics Cameras come pre-calibrated, however, if prompted you may be reqired to calibrate your camera. Calibration unlocks several key features designed to enhance the functionality and control of your camera within the Hive Studio. These features include:
- Click to Center
- Cine Center
- Cine Frame
- Fast Frame
- Joystick or Zoom Tools Control
How to Calibrate/Recalibrate Your Camera
Depending on the camera model, The process typically takes 5 to 10 minutes. Follow these steps to complete the calibration process.
Steps
1. Accessing Calibration Settings: Navigate to your camera’s advanced settings by clicking the settings icon on the source card or double-clicking the source card and selecting “Calibrate.”
2. Initiating Calibration: Upon accessing the advanced settings, locate and press the “Calibrate” button at the top. A modal will appear with tips and tricks for successful calibration
3. Calibration Process: After starting the calibration, your camera will undergo a routine encompassing pan, tilt, and zoom speed adjustments, focal calibration, and zoom calibration. A progress indicator will display the completion percentage
4. Completion: Once calibration reaches 100%, the settings are automatically saved, and you won’t need to recalibrate unless necessary.
